The Regulatory Environment: Building Trust and Transparency
In 2014, the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) introduced rigorous licensing standards to ensure player safety and uphold industry integrity. This regulatory framework mandates robust Know Your Customer (KYC) processes, anti-money laundering measures, and strict advertising codes. As a result, licensed operators are held to high standards, fostering a safer environment for players.
Despite challenges, compliance with UKGC guidelines enhances player trust, leading to a more sustainable industry.
Technological Innovations Shaping the Industry
Cutting-edge technologies are revolutionizing player experiences and operational efficiencies in the digital gaming sector. Notably:
- Mobile Gaming: With over 70% of gambling transactions occurring on smartphones (Gaming Innovation Group, 2023), mobile-optimized platforms are now a must for operators.
- Live Dealer Games: Offering real-time interaction, live dealer titles combine the convenience of online play with the authenticity of brick-and-mortar casinos.
- Artificial Intelligence: AI-driven personalization enhances user engagement by providing tailored game recommendations and responsible gaming tools.
Consumer Expectations and Responsible Gaming
Modern players demand transparency, fairness, and safety. They increasingly seek platforms that demonstrate a commitment to responsible gambling, including features such as self-exclusion, deposit limits, and real-time account monitoring. According to recent surveys, over 65% of UK players value operators that actively promote player welfare (Gambling Commission, 2023).
To meet these expectations, many operators are adopting advanced security protocols and leveraging data analytics to detect gambling-related problems early.
